Description

This episode explores how neurodiversity shows up across the construction industry, from ADHD and dyslexia to autism and beyond. Sara Hannak and Don Bennett discuss why so many neurodivergent people are drawn to the trades, how understanding your brain can improve mental health and the practical tools, support and workplace changes that can help people thrive.
